Tx Notif. Enable. Indicates to the LLDP agent whether SNMP (traps) notifications
must be sent when changes occur in the remote information received in the interface.
In order for SNMP notifications to be effectively sent, they must be explicitly
allowed to be sent in the SNMP menu.
PortDesc. Indicates to the LLDP agent whether or not to include the optional field
with the descriptive information of the interface in the LLDP messages sent. The
value of the field is the text of the Description parameter of the Port menu (see 5.4).
SysName. Indicates to the LLDP agent whether or not to include the optional field
with the name of the device in the LLDP messages sent. The value of the field is the
text of the Hostname parameter of the main menu (see 5.1.1).
SysDesc. Indicates to the LLDP agent whether or not to include the optional field
with the description of the device in the LLDP messages sent. The value of the
parameter is obtained automatically from the running firmware, so it is not subject to
changes by the user.
SysCap. Indicates to the LLDP agent whether or not to include the optional field with
the device capabilities in the LLDP messages sent. The coding of the field is set in
the standard and it is made up of flags. The value is automatically inserted.
Tx Mgmt. Indicates to the LLDP agent whether or not to include the optional field
with the management address of the device in the LLDP messages sent. The value
to be sent is set by the Mgmt Address parameter.
Mgmt Address. It allows the user to set the value of the optional field that reports
the management address of the device.
The protocol has its own statistics that show the data specific to the execution of the
protocol in each interface as part of the information received.
